πŸ“± Redmi A4 5G πŸ†š Poco M6 5G: The Ultimate Showdown πŸ₯Š

When it comes to budget-friendly 5G smartphones, two models are currently making waves in India – the Redmi A4 5G and the Poco M6 5G. Both offer impressive features at an affordable price, but which one takes the cake? Let’s find out! 🧐

1️⃣ Key Features πŸ“

πŸ”Ή Display πŸ“Ί

The Redmi A4 5G boasts a 6.67″ Full HD+ IPS LCD display, providing vibrant visuals and crisp images. The Poco M6 5G, on the other hand, features a slightly larger 6.7″ display with the same Full HD+ resolution, but its Super AMOLED panel offers deeper blacks and more vibrant colours.

πŸ”Ή Performance πŸš€

Both phones are powered by MediaTek Dimensity chipsets, ensuring smooth performance. However, the Poco M6 5G’s Dimensity 700 processor has a slight edge over the Redmi A4 5G’s Dimensity 620 when it comes to processing speed and power efficiency.

πŸ”Ή Camera πŸ“Έ

The Redmi A4 5G comes with a triple-camera setup with a 48MP main sensor, while the Poco M6 5G sports a quad-camera system with a 64MP primary sensor. Both offer great photo quality, but Poco M6 5G’s additional ultra-wide sensor gives it an edge in the camera department.

πŸ”Ή Battery πŸ”‹

Both phones come with a 5000mAh battery that can easily last a day. However, the Redmi A4 5G supports 18W fast charging, while the Poco M6 5G supports 15W, giving the Redmi a slight advantage in terms of charging speed.

πŸ”Ή Price πŸ’°

In terms of price, the Redmi A4 5G is a bit cheaper than the Poco M6 5G, making it a more budget-friendly option.

2️⃣ Comparison Table πŸ“Š

Features Redmi A4 5G Poco M6 5G
Display 6.67″ Full HD+ IPS LCD 6.7″ Full HD+ Super AMOLED
Processor MediaTek Dimensity 620 MediaTek Dimensity 700
Camera 48MP Triple Camera 64MP Quad Camera
Battery & Charging 5000mAh with 18W Fast Charging 5000mAh with 15W Fast Charging
Price Less Expensive More Expensive

3️⃣ Final Conclusion 🎯

Both Redmi A4 5G and Poco M6 5G are excellent choices for budget 5G smartphones. However, if you prefer a better camera and display, go for the Poco M6 5G. If you’re on a tight budget and need faster charging, the Redmi A4 5G is the way to go. Ultimately, the choice depends on your personal preferences and needs. πŸ€·β€β™‚οΈ
